Formulators and beauty brands are constantly searching for plant oils that balance efficacy, sensory feel, and marketing appeal. Macadamia oil hits that sweet spot: it’s light, rapidly absorbed, and rich in palmitoleic acid — a fatty acid beneficial for skin barrier repair and youthful appearance. Those properties make it attractive for moisturizers, serums, hair oils, and body care.

Hydration has moved from afterthought to anchor strategy for athletes and active consumers. Even mild dehydration can impair endurance, cognitive function, and heat tolerance—especially in hot, humid environments. The market has responded with an explosion of electrolyte mixes, RTDs, and gels that balance sodium, potassium, magnesium, and carbohydrates for diverse training conditions. The winners are products that align formulation with physiology and provide simple, actionable dosing.

Electrolyte needs vary widely. Heavy sweaters and heat-exposed athletes may require higher sodium per hour than casual gym-goers. Carbohydrate content should reflect session goals: low/no-carb for fasted or low-intensity training, and 30–90g/hour for extended endurance efforts. Magnesium and potassium support muscle function, but dosing must avoid GI distress. Clear labeling with per-serving milligrams—and guidance per liter of water—helps consumers tailor intake.
